This year continues to reveal the many ways that we must recover, reimagine and rebuild our nation so that it works for everyone. The two destructive pandemics—COVID-19 and systemic racism—have exposed, for the world to see, how inequity continues to eat away at the foundation of our country.

Everything that we do at the San Francisco Foundation is in service of our North Star: creating a Bay Area where everyone can get a good job, live in an affordable home, and exercise their voice, no matter their skin color or zip code.

This year, the San Francisco Foundation successfully pushed for swift protections and policies for the Bay Area residents hit the hardest by multiple crises. In addition to issuing emergency COVID-19 grants to nearly 400 frontline organizations, we used our voice, research expertise, and convening power. These efforts advanced just policies, helped keep people in their homes, and will ensure a historic turnout in a critical election year.

All of this work was made possible by the Bay Area Leads Fund. More than ever, the fund has an urgent role to play. We are deeply grateful to partner with you on our shared vision of a truly inclusive Bay Area.
